WebOct 1, 2024 · Z88.8 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. Short description: Allergy status to other drug/meds/biol subst; The 2024 edition of ICD-10-CM Z88.8 became effective on October 1, 2024. WebOct 1, 2024 · Z88.5 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. The 2024 edition of ICD-10-CM Z88.5 became effective on October 1, 2024.
